More and more countries in Europe started a challenging change following the vision of a common ‘European Higher Education Area” which has taken on structure and shape within the scope of the Bologna process.
The internationalization of universities is a response to the challenges of globalization, and is one of the most important objectives of the Bologna Process. The key aims of the Bologna Process are directed toward the comparability of educational systems, more transparency, and verifiable educational contents, in order to establish the same standards in higher education across Europe.
